What Can You Add to a Digital Business Card?

Stepping into the digital age doesn't have to be a Herculean task. With a digital business card, you're armed with a personal arsenal of networking firepower. No more digging through code or wrestling with website design. Just a sleek representation of you and your brand in the palm of your hand.

But what exactly can you pack into this digital powerhouse? Let's break it down and unveil the features that transform a simple contact exchange into a dynamic networking experience.

  • Contact Information: The backbone of any business card, digital or otherwise, is your contact information. Make it count!
  • Social Media Links: Seamlessly connect clients to your social media profiles with one click, bridging the gap between platforms.
  • Professional Headshot: Put a face to the name with a photo that exudes confidence and approachability.
  • Portfolio Samples: Flaunt your best work. Give prospective clients a taste of your skillset right off the bat.
  • Lead Form Integration: Capture leads directly from your digital card with an integrated form, no extra steps required.
  • Customizable Designs: Reflect your personal brand with customizable templates that speak to your unique style.
  • Visitor Tracking: Get insights into who views your card, so you can tailor follow-ups and gauge interest.
  • Instant Updates: Switched jobs or got a new number? Update your details in minutes, ensuring you're always current.
  • Interactive Elements: Add a video introduction or an interactive portfolio to stand out from the crowd.
  • Call-to-Action Buttons: Whether it's scheduling a consultation or downloading a resume, direct actions are a tap away.

Where to use your digital card? 

A digital business card is a strategic tool that's not only versatile but also a breeze to share. Think of it as your personal handshake in the digital world, extending your reach far beyond the local coffee shop meetups.

Now, let’s explore the myriad of ways this tool can amplify your online presence and open doors to new opportunities.

  • Social Media Savvy: Slide into your network's DMs with a link to your digital card. It’s the perfect follow-up to an engaging tweet or LinkedIn discussion.
  • Email Signature Power Move: Make every email a networking chance. Include your digital card in the signature, and you’re introducing yourself with pizzazz, one send button at a time.
  • Text Messaging Mastery: Quick and direct, a text with your digital card feels personal and is ideal for follow-ups after a call or meeting.
  • QR Code Convenience: Post a QR code in strategic places or on physical materials, so folks can scan and instantly connect with you.
  • Virtual Event Networking: Share your digital card in webinars or Zoom chat boxes. It's like passing your card across the virtual table.
  • Online Forums and Communities: Engage in discussions on platforms like Reddit or Quora? Leave a subtle link to your digital card for interested parties.
  • Freelancer Platforms: Stand out on sites like Upwork or Fiverr by linking to your digital card in your profile for a full spectrum view of who you are.
  • Video Calls Background: Display a QR code or URL in your video background during calls. It’s a visual nudge for new contacts to connect.
  • Networking Apps: Many apps are built for digital networking. Sync your digital card and make swapping details as easy as a swipe.
  • Blog or Content Footer: If you’re showcasing your expertise through content, end with a link to your digital card – a call-to-action that invites more than just comments.
  • Local Business Partnerships: Team up with local businesses and leave a QR code for their customers to discover your services.
  • Presentation Slides: Include your digital card info in presentations. It’s an invite for your audience to keep the conversation going.
